Five coaches nominated for FIFA's The Best awards

news banner image

FIFA have announced the list of the five nominees for The Best FIFA Coach of the Year 2022. The nominees are: Lionel Scaloni, Carlo Ancelotti, Pep Guardiola, Walid Regragui and Didier Deschamps.

Thomas Tuchel, who managed Chelsea, was named The Best coach of 2021 by FIFA. The German boss was chosen ahead of Spain's Pep Guardiola and Italy's Roberto Mancini.
Carlo Ancelotti (Real Madrid)
The Italian coach managed to win the Champions League, La Liga and the UEFA Super Cup with Madrid. He is also the only manager to have won the top European club title four times.
Pep Guardiola (Manchester City)
The Spanish boss lifted his fourth Premier League title in five seasons with his current club. He also played an important role after being eliminated against Real Madrid in the Champions League.
Walid Regragui (Morocco)
The North African team were the surprise package of the World Cup in Qatar after eliminating Belgium, Spain and Portugal. Regragui made Morocco the first African team to reach the semi-finals of a World Cup.
Didier Deschamps (France)
The French coach took the national team far in the World Cup despite losing to Argentina.
Lionel Scaloni (Argentina)
The Argentine coach made history by winning the third World Cup for the 'Albiceleste'. They had not won one since 1986. Moreover, Scaloni has only lost one of his last 43 matches as coach.
